## Formula sandbox tuning

User-supplied formulas in Gridmoor execute inside a restricted interpreter with hard ceilings on time, memory, and call depth. Reviewers should confirm any change to these ceilings is justified in the PR description, since raising them widens the abuse surface. Defaults were chosen from production traces. The current limits are as follows.

limits module of tafog-fawip:
WEIGHTS = {
    "julix": 57,
    "lamys": 992,
    "kasvan": 209,
    "quenok": 750,
    "alddor": 259,
    "oliath": 1009,
    "wenix": 815,
}

## Role-Based Access for Plugin Authors

The Fernledger wiki enforces role-based access at the page-tree level. Plugins run with the permissions of the service role they're registered under, not the viewing user's role, so scope your reads carefully. Most external plugins should request the reader-plus role, which allows page reads and comment writes but no structural changes. Requests for broader roles go through the platform review queue. To exercise the plugin API in the sandbox tenant, authenticate with the following key:

app token of bahaf-tajeg = zpat23_SjjsllwiLmXbtS65veZaV47

Step 4: String extraction. Run the Linguaforge extractor against the Parakeet frontend before cutting the release branch. It walks every template in src/views, pulls tagged strings into locale/pending.pot, and fails loudly on duplicate msgids. Do not hand-edit the .pot file; the Veltrano translation desk rejects manual changes. Commit the regenerated catalog, tag it rc-candidate, and push to the staging mirror. The upload step signs the catalog bundle before the mirror accepts it. Use the signing key below.

rollout seal: bky4_DFM9